How the OSRS Gold Economy Works
OSRS gold has value because it is constantly being removed and reintroduced into the game. Gold enters the economy through monster drops, alchemy, and rewards, while gold sinks such as death fees, item degradation, construction costs, and NPC services remove GP.
At the same time, item prices fluctuate based on:
New content releases
Boss popularity and drop rates
Skilling demand
Player trends and metas
For example, when a new boss is released, demand for combat supplies spikes. When a skilling update arrives, raw materials often increase in value. Players who understand these patterns can profit without even changing how they play.
How to Make OSRS Gold Efficiently
Beginner Gold Methods
New players should focus on low-risk, consistent money makers that also build core skills:
Fishing shrimp, anchovies, and lobsters for steady income
Mining iron ore, one of the most reliable early-game GP methods
Woodcutting oak and willow logs for AFK-friendly profit
Cowhides and Hill Giants for simple combat-based gold
These methods won’t generate millions per hour, but they establish a stable financial foundation.
Mid-Level Gold Strategies
As your account progresses, gold generation becomes more efficient.
Slayer is one of the best long-term OSRS gold engines:
Trains combat while earning GP
Unlocks monsters with valuable drops
Scales naturally as stats increase
Bossing becomes a major income source:
Barrows offers low-cost, repeatable profit
Zulrah provides high GP/hour with experience
Vorkath is known for consistent, predictable returns
At this stage, efficiency matters more than raw luck.
High-Level Gold Methods
Endgame OSRS gold revolves around skill-based PvM.
Raids such as Chambers of Xeric, Theatre of Blood, and Tombs of Amascut offer the highest profit potential in the game. Unique drops can be worth tens or hundreds of millions of GP, making raids one of the fastest ways to grow a bank.
Elite bosses like Nex, Corporeal Beast, and Phosani’s Nightmare also provide massive returns, especially for coordinated teams with optimized gear.
How to Save OSRS Gold (Avoiding Common GP Traps)
Many players lose millions of GP without realizing it. Saving gold is just as important as making it.
Common mistakes include:
Over-upgrading gear too early
Buying niche items instead of DPS upgrades
Ignoring supply costs when calculating profit
Panic-selling items during short-term price dips
Smart players delay luxury upgrades and focus on items that directly improve kill speed or efficiency.

Investing for Long-Term Gains
Some players treat OSRS gold like an investment portfolio:
Buying items before updates
Holding supplies expected to rise in demand
Avoiding short-term panic trades
While riskier than flipping, smart investing can lead to massive gains during major content releases.
